van-cascader按需引入报错

报错:<van-cascader> - did you register the component correctly? For recursive components, make sure to provide the "name" option

解决:利用全局引入,或者使用组件的 name 属性作为键来解决

1.全局引入

javascript 复制代码
//在当前页或者main.js直接全局引入
import { Cascader } from "vant";
import Vue from "vue";
Vue.use(Cascader);

2.利用[Cascader.name]: Cascader来局部引入

javascript 复制代码
//在当前页按需引入即可
import { Cascader } from "vant";
components: { [Cascader.name]: Cascader },
相关推荐
郝学胜-神的一滴5 分钟前
Python魔法函数一览:解锁面向对象编程的奥秘
开发语言·python·程序人生
San30.7 分钟前
深入理解 JavaScript:手写 `instanceof` 及其背后的原型链原理
开发语言·javascript·ecmascript
北冥有一鲲16 分钟前
LangChain.js:RAG 深度解析与全栈实践
开发语言·javascript·langchain
Code Warrior28 分钟前
【C++】智能指针的使用及其原理
开发语言·c++
05大叔28 分钟前
多线程的学习
java·开发语言·学习
lly20240636 分钟前
C 位域:深度解析其概念、应用与未来趋势
开发语言
刺客xs38 分钟前
多路IO复用
开发语言
用户289079421627141 分钟前
Spec-Kit应用指南
前端
酸菜土狗1 小时前
🔥 手写 Vue 自定义指令:实现内容区拖拽调整大小(超实用)
前端
ohyeah1 小时前
深入理解 React Hooks:useState 与 useEffect 的核心原理与最佳实践
前端·react.js